A matrix effect-free bleomycin assay in detecting non-protein binding iron of newborn cord plasma by a standard plasma

Abstract: Objective To establish a practical method of detecting cord plasma nonprotein bound iron(NPBI). M ethods Of 20 cord plasma samples,10 of mormal, 10 of asphyxial newborns, respectively, their NPBI were investigated by traditional and corrected blo emycin assay. Their standard curves, recovery rates and t-test statistical results were compared. Results We found the cord plasma NPBI were lower detected by tra ditional bleomycin assay in normal and asphyxial newborns, their recovery rate was only about 32%. There is an obviousely matrix effect. Though the NPBI of normal and asphyxial ne wborns had still significant difference by t-test,the NPBI values were so l ow th at it's easily disturbed and difficult to practice on clinical use. The detecte d results were improved by matrix effec-free bleomycin assay. Their rec overy rat es were reached about 101%and the NPBI values had statistical significant d iffe rence between normal and asphyxial newborn. Conclusion The matri x effec-free bleo mycin assay is a stable, real and better method to estimate the concentration of plasma NPBI practically on clinical use.
